you need a special socket either 4 prong or if early axle 6 prong, or you can use a punch and hammer, basically there is an inner hub nut, and an outer hub nut with a keyed washer inbetween. All of that must be removed to pull the hub off the spindle. The outer bearing will just fall out, so be careful.
If you remove the outer bearing, put the inner hub nut back on the spindle and then remove the hub assembly, the inner hub seal pops right off so you have access the the inner bearing without damaging the hub seal...
